28 Porchester Close, Hartley, Longfield, DA3 7DQ is a freehold terraced property built between 1976-1982. The property offers approximately 732 square feet of living space. In this location, properties of similar size usually have two bedrooms.

The estimated current market value of the property is £241,384 , which equates to approximately £330 per square foot. It was last sold on 3 Nov 2023 for £230,000. Since then, the value has increased by £11,384, representing a 4.9% increase, or approximately 2.3% per year.

28 Porchester Close, Hartley, Longfield, Sevenoaks, Kent, DA3 7DQ has an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) rating of D, based on the latest assessment carried out on 15 Jan 2019.

This property uses a gas-fired boiler and radiators, connected to the mains gas supply, as its main heating source. Hot water is provided from main heating system. The windows are fully double glazed.

The previous EPC assessment was conducted on 3 Dec 2014. The rating of D remains the same, but the energy efficiency score improved by 14%.

Since the previous assessment, several changes were observed:

  • The heating system changed from warm air, mains gas to boiler and radiators, mains gas, with no change in energy efficiency (good).
  • The hot water energy efficiency improving from average to good, while the system remained as from main system.
  • The roof construction or insulation changed from pitched, limited insulation (assumed) to pitched, 75 mm loft insulation, improving energy efficiency from very poor to average.
  • The wall construction or insulation changed from cavity wall, as built, no insulation (assumed) to cavity wall, as built, partial insulation (assumed), improving energy efficiency from poor to average.
  • The lighting was changed from low energy lighting in 75% of fixed outlets to low energy lighting in 83% of fixed outlets, with no change in efficiency (very good).
